How to Plan a Romantic Dinner at Home for Your Husband

Going out to a restaurant can be a special event, but sometimes when your husband gets home from a hard day at work, all he wants to do is relax. At times like that, you can plan a romantic dinner at home to surprise him and spice up your lives.

Difficulty: Moderate
Instructions

Things You'll Need:

  • Romantic accent pieces
  • Kitchen appliances and supplies

    Prepare for Dinner

  1. Step 1

    Determine what time your husband will be home. If you want to keep the romantic dinner a surprise, you can ask one of his coworkers to make sure he doesn't leave until a certain time.

  2. Step 2

    Choose a menu. You can find recipes in cookbooks, online or by asking friends for suggestions.

  3. Step 3

    Buy the food you will need to prepare the meal.

  4. Step 4

    Buy accent pieces. Romantic dinners can include candles, fancy napkins, flowers and other romantic touches.

  5. Step 5

    Do any prep work needed. Some recipes call for time for foods to chill, so you may need to prepare those in advance.

  6. Cook Dinner

  7. Step 1

    Prepare the food for the meal according to your recipes.

  8. Step 2

    Set the table while the food is cooking.

  9. Step 3

    Wash dirty dishes as you go, so you won't have to do it later.

  10. Serve the Meal

  11. Step 1

    Set out the first course moments before your main man gets home.

  12. Step 2

    Use your microwave or oven to keep other courses warm while you are eating.

  13. Step 3

    Enjoy the romantic meal.

Tips & Warnings
  • After dinner, put the dishes in the sink and save them for tomorrow. It's better to continue having a romantic evening with your husband than to worry about doing chores.
  • If you've never prepared the meal before, have a back-up plan in case it doesn't work out.
